Medical group examining Beverly Hills fertility doctor in octuplets case

 |  By HealthLeaders Media Staff  
   February 11, 2009

The American Society for Reproductive Medicine said it is going to look into the case of a mother who gave birth to octuplets, and who now has 14 children. The mother, 33-year-old Nadya Suleman, went to a Beverly Hills doctor, whose fertility treatment led to the birth of her octuplets and her six previous children. West Coast IVF Clinic is run by Michael M. Kamrava, MD, who has declined to comment about the case. The California Medical Board previously announced an investigation, and the reproductive medicine society is now following suit.
